"Why don't they let the price float freely, independent of fossil diesel?"
You've probably forgotten the answer to that: "Because we can."

After all, everyone is in the game to make a profit. Why sell cheap and spoil the market, when you can make your investors happy by selling higher? DIY will always be cheaper since you have no rent, insurance (for hazmat substances, spills, and liability/damage to customers' engines) or any of the other nasty business overheads. Although I'm told that home-brewers of bio-d are having a hard time getting WVO these days, as recyclers are willing to pay the restaurants to take it--and they won't allow anyone else to touch the tanks THEY supply.
